LOS ANGELES, WI (WTAQ) - A Fox Valley man who graduated from UW Eau Claire will match wits with two other contestants on “Jeopardy.” Jared Balkman, 30, who lives in the town of Grand Chute near Appleton, will appear on Monday’s show. Balkman passed a 50-question test online, and was then selected to audition in Chicago in May of last year. There, he took another 50-question test and competed in several mock “Jeopardy” rounds. Then, Balkman was placed into an 18-month selection pool in which contestants are picked for the show. Balkman almost gave up his hopes of being selected when he got the call in August to go out to Los Angeles. He competed on August 29th – and of course, he was sworn to secrecy about how he did.
